区块链2.0:语言探索和发展

            发布时间:2023-12-25 10:01:33

            什么是区块链2.0?

            区块链2.0是指在比特币区块链的基础上,通过引入智能合约功能和更高级别的编程语言,进一步扩展和完善区块链系统。它提供了更强大的功能,并能够支持更广泛的应用场景。

            区块链2.0需要哪些编程语言?

            在区块链2.0中,有几种主要的编程语言被广泛使用。其中最为知名的是Solidity,它是以太坊平台上智能合约的主要编程语言。此外,Rust、Golang、JavaScript和Python也是常见的区块链2.0开发语言。

            Solidity是什么?

            Solidity是一种面向以太坊平台的智能合约编程语言。它类似于JavaScript,但也引入了一些特殊的功能和语法,以支持区块链的特定需求。Solidity可以用于编写智能合约,这些合约可以在以太坊区块链上执行,并实现各种功能,如数字货币、去中心化应用(DApp)等。

            Rust在区块链2.0开发中的应用如何?

            Rust是一种系统级编程语言,因其高度安全性和并发性能而在区块链2.0开发中受到关注。Rust代码编译后可以生成高效且安全的可执行文件,这使得它在开发区块链核心功能和智能合约方面具有潜力。Rust还可以用于构建高性能的区块链节点和开发工具。

            Golang在区块链2.0开发中的优势是什么?

            Golang(Go)是一种开发效率高且具有强大并发能力的编程语言,因此在区块链2.0开发过程中得到广泛应用。Go的并发模型和轻量级线程(goroutine)使其轻松处理区块链中的高并发需求,同时其简洁的语法和内置的网络库也让开发者能够快速构建高性能的分布式应用。

            JavaScript在区块链2.0开发中的角色如何?

            JavaScript是一种广泛应用于前端和后端开发的脚本语言,在区块链2.0的开发中也发挥着重要的作用。通过使用JavaScript开发框架,如Node.js,开发者可以构建区块链节点、编写智能合约和开发去中心化应用。JavaScript还可以与其他语言进行集成,为区块链2.0的开发提供更多的灵活性。

            问题7:Python在区块链2.0开发中有何优势?

            Python是一种简单易学、拥有强大生态系统的编程语言,在区块链2.0开发中具有许多优势。Python在数据处理和科学计算方面具有出色的性能,这使其在区块链数据分析和智能合约开发中得到广泛应用。此外,Python还有许多成熟的库和框架可以用于构建区块链应用程序。

            分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          比特币钱包类型及其特点
                                          2024-01-05
                                          比特币钱包类型及其特点

                                          比特币钱包有哪些类型? 比特币钱包有多种类型,常见的包括软件钱包、硬件钱包、在线钱包和手机钱包。 软件钱包...

                                          如何安全地储存比特币?
                                          2024-06-04
                                          如何安全地储存比特币?

                                          大纲: 一. 比特币储存的重要性 二. 比特币钱包的种类 a. 软件钱包 b. 硬件钱包 c. 纸钱包 d. 网络钱包 三. 如何选择合适...

                                          USDT钱包及使用指南
                                          2024-06-17
                                          USDT钱包及使用指南

                                          概述 USDT钱包是一种数字资产存储工具,用于存储和管理加密货币中的USDT(Tether)。USDT是一种与法定货币挂钩的加密...

                                          如何轻松查找比特币钱包
                                          2024-10-05
                                          如何轻松查找比特币钱包

                                          在加密货币的世界中,比特币作为最早和最知名的数字货币之一,吸引了大量的投资者和开发者。对于比特币的使用...

                                                                    <abbr draggable="onz9x5"></abbr><pre dir="1enst4"></pre><code lang="z44nz4"></code><em draggable="xti2ng"></em><b dropzone="xllm07"></b><em lang="7g78q7"></em><kbd id="_s5pl1"></kbd><ins dir="p417ug"></ins><map draggable="gkcgjf"></map><address date-time="ufymjo"></address><abbr lang="nxxtqy"></abbr><noscript date-time="zpwdyo"></noscript><address dropzone="4mlkfg"></address><kbd lang="2mvage"></kbd><abbr date-time="sq1cqb"></abbr><style lang="hj0tt8"></style><b draggable="xajs_z"></b><bdo date-time="mowtr_"></bdo><center draggable="msav_9"></center><acronym date-time="c70lxw"></acronym><legend draggable="i95qsl"></legend><acronym lang="e4h082"></acronym><map lang="2_wses"></map><i dropzone="2na_0i"></i><style date-time="ycys0x"></style><tt dropzone="2e3jof"></tt><address draggable="ueli37"></address><del id="js4ery"></del><code dir="0jf3eg"></code><map date-time="g8urnb"></map><time draggable="qb_t0i"></time><dl draggable="ah_z58"></dl><code date-time="pgotcb"></code><dfn date-time="r3ubf9"></dfn><acronym date-time="cacqzy"></acronym><noframes dir="ftwdt5">

                                                                      标签